Sopa de Rape y Almendras

Catalan monkfish soup, thickened with a picada of toasted almonds, bread and saffron.

Instructions

  1. Remove the skin and central bone from the monkfish, cut into 3 cm cubes, salt and chill until needed.
  2. Heat 3 tbsp olive oil and toast the almonds, bread slices and two garlic cloves over medium heat for 3–4 min. until golden brown; remove and process with the saffron and a little broth in a mortar or blender into a smooth picada.
  3. Finely chop the onion and remaining garlic and sauté in the leftover oil over gentle heat for 6–8 min. until soft without coloring.
  4. Add the peeled, diced tomatoes and reduce for 8 min. until the mixture is dark and jammy, then deglaze with the white wine and let it evaporate for 2 min.
  5. Pour in the vegetable stock, simmer for 10 min., stir in the picada and let it thicken gently for another 5 min. until the soup turns slightly creamy.
  6. Add the fish cubes and let them sit off the heat for 4–5 min. until translucent white, season with salt and pepper and serve sprinkled with chopped parsley.
